The scope of his work ranges from objects and sculptures to the large-scale architecture installations EarthCloud and SkyWell Falls. His abstract interpretations of American landscapes using the raku technique have an almost eerie presence, plasticity and technical perfection. Their theme is philosophical: 'My work is a meditation on the relationship between spirit and matter. It is not about landscape.' (W. Higby).
